t Install the lamp unit cover, and
then use a Phillips screwdriver
to securely tighten the lamp
unit cover fixing screws.
NOTE:
• Be sure to install the lamp unit
and the lamp unit cover securely.
If they are not securely installed, it
may cause the protection circuit to
operate so that the power cannot
be turned on.
y Insert the power cord plug into
the wall outlet and then press
the MAIN POWER switch.
NOTE:
• If the POWER indicator on the
projector does not illuminate red
when the MAIN POWER switch is
turned on, turn the MAIN POWER
switch off again and check that
the lamp unit and the lamp unit
cover are securely installed. Then
turn the MAIN POWER switch
back on.
u Press the POWER button so
that a picture is projected onto
the screen.

!0 Press and hold the ENTER
button for approximately 3
seconds.
Lamp Time Reset
Power OFF
OK
The "Lamp Time Reset" will be
displayed.
!1 Select "OK" by pressing the
or
buttons and press the
ENTER button.
NOTE:
• If "CANCEL" is selected in step
!0 , the operation for resetting the
lamp time will be cancelled.

!2 Turn off the power.

This will reset the cumulative
usage time for the lamp unit to
zero.
Refer to steps e and r on page
28
for details on how to turn off
the power.
